So I haven't even touched on the awesomeness of the condo that we have rented. For three years running, Regal Palms. www.regalpalms.com So great, So affordable. Most people when they go to Florida are all about "staying on Disney". While I am not opposed to that (and we have done it), here is what I have figured out for our family dynamic and why we do not even attempt the hotel thing any more: 


WE NEED SPACE, so at the end of a long day or an exhausting vacation, everyone is not in everyone's face. We love each other, but after 12 hours at a park, its nice to send the kids to their bedroom.


These condos are so affordable and have sooo much space. A mere 20-30 minute drive away from the parks, and these condos are huge. Okay, that is three times now that I have mentioned the space, but I think it is an important feature given the per night rate. Think 4 bedroom 3 1/2 bathrooms for about $110 per night. Full kitchen, dishwasher, tv's in every room.  TV in the kids' room is such a treat for them...it doesn't take much. 
There's more. The best part is the pool area:
  •  a cool, not overwhelming water slide (that excites your 3 year old and his 62 year old grandfather), 
  • a lazy river (to float with your tube and have a conversation with your increasingly disconnected 10 year old daughter)
  •  a regular pool (for handstands, cheering stunts, and getting whacked in the head with a wild football toss)
  • a walk-out, beach-style pool for toddlers (so you can watch them and not hold them 100% of the time)
  • a hot tub (in case the weather bombs during your trip)
  • a dj
  •  a tiki bar
  • hair wrapping for the little lady in your life (way cheaper than downtown Disney)
  • ...ok I could go on and on and on....

Bottom line...
This place makes my family slow down
